3. Leeds (early 2000s)
Leeds, within the early years of the Premier League, have been big-spenders and a membership with ambitions of difficult on the very prime. And that’s what they did, for probably the most half, ending as excessive as third within the 1999-2000 season.
They spent massive on the likes of Rio Ferdinand, Robbie Keane, Robbie Fowler, Seth Johnson and Mark Viduka. However these have been transfers the membership couldn’t afford, notably after failing to qualify for the Champions League in 2001 and 2002 and lacking out on the assured earnings from Europe’s most prestigious competitors.
Chairman Peter Risdale had taken out sizeable loans, assuming the membership would generate sufficient earnings to cowl their switch outlay. However the money owed began to mount and Leeds spiralled right into a monetary disaster. They have been pressured to promote their big-name gamers and have been relegated in 2004, not returning to the highest flight till 2020.

5. Chelsea (2015/16 season)

After beginning with Chelsea, we’ll end with them too. It would reassure the membership’s followers that they’ve some earlier expertise with surprising implosions.
The 2015/16 season was among the many worst within the membership’s historical past, actually given the context. Chelsea had received the title the earlier season beneath Mourinho, shedding simply three video games within the course of.
However issues fell aside only a few months later. A dismal begin to the marketing campaign noticed Chelsea languishing close to the relegation zone, and after Mourinho’s eventual dismissal, there wasn’t a lot of an enchancment. They finally climbed to mid-table, ending tenth, a reminder to the richest golf equipment that nothing is assured.
The next season, in fact, Chelsea received the title once more, this time beneath Antonio Conte. So worry not, Blues followers, finally issues will work out for one of the best. Most likely.
